Can you explain online trading? - Online trading refers to a web-based platform is used by investors to buy and sell various financial instruments like stocks, bonds, commodities, currencies, and other derivatives. This is done through web-based brokerage accounts, where trade orders can be placed by traders with a few clicks, with transactions being processed in real-time afterwards. To start trading, the investor must open an online trading account with a trustworthy brokerage firm and deposit a specific sum of money. They have the ability to track market trends, evaluate different assets' performance, and make decisions based on the real-time data provided by the trading platform. The convenience, speed, and ease of use make online trading a popular choice for many investors.

However, it's vital to adhere to certain tips to make certain of a successful trading experience. Do's consist of carrying out thorough research and assessment prior to doing any trades, spreading your investment portfolio to lessen risk, and determining a spending limit or limit on your investing to prevent financial stress. It's additionally important to keep up to date on industry changes and information that might influence your investment decisions. Conversely, don'ts include making impulsive decisions founded on emotions or market gossip, overlooking to inspect the reliability of the online trading website, and putting in more than you can afford to lose. Also, don't ignore the importance of having a well-organized trading strategy and frequently assessing and adjusting it as essential.

Selecting a reliable online trading platform requires careful consideration and research. First, identify your trading needs and goals. Afterwards, look for a platform that offers the tools and features you require, such as real-time data, advanced charting capabilities, robust research tools, and a user-friendly interface. Security should be a top priority, so ensure the platform uses high-level encryption and adheres to regulatory standards. Check if the platform has a good reputation by reading reviews and testimonials from other users. Also, consider the cost of using the platform, including trading fees and commissions. Finally, ensure it offers excellent customer support to assist with any issues or inquiries.

As long as it abides by certain Islamic principles, online trading is regarded as halal, or online trading Saudi Arabia permissible, in Islam. These principles include engaging in trade transactions that are clear of ambiguity, deceit, and fraud. Moreover, the commodities or services being traded should also be halal, meaning they should not involve anything that Islam prohibits such as alcohol or pork. Additionally, online trading should not involve interest (riba), as earning or paying interest is strictly forbidden in Islam. Thus, if these conditions are fulfilled, online trading is considered halal in Islam.
